Description
Undertakes duties in support of the Pharmacists and other Technical Staff. Assists in the provision of a safe and effective pharmaceutical service in order to meet department and corporate objectives.

Reception duties within the department

Receipt and storage of medications

Provide a ward stock topping up service to wards and departments

Dispensing pharmaceutical products

Contribute to 7 day service, Bank Holidays and Late Night Rotas

Undertake NVQ level 2 in Pharmaceutical Service


The Northern Care Alliance NHS Foundation Trust (NCA) provides hospital and integrated health and social care services to over one million people living across Greater Manchester.

Our 20,000 colleagues care for people in hospital and in the community, working across Bury, Rochdale, Oldham and Salford, to save and improve lives.


As a large NHS trust we are committed to enhancing the health of our local population by delivering consistently high standards of care and working closely with local authorities and key partners.
